From eadd5784244d98dca21e5788440004432af8e803 Mon Sep 17 00:00:00 2001
From: kongdeqiang <123456>
Date: 星期二, 12 九月 2023 15:45:20 +0800
Subject: [PATCH] 修改前端页面

---
 src/components/page/Index2.vue |   75 +++++++++++++++++++++++++------------
 1 files changed, 51 insertions(+), 24 deletions(-)

diff --git a/src/components/page/Index2.vue b/src/components/page/Index2.vue
index d431dc7..95653ca 100644
--- a/src/components/page/Index2.vue
+++ b/src/components/page/Index2.vue
@@ -37,14 +37,22 @@
                             <el-button class="jiaofei-btn" type="primary" @click="pay()" :loading="payFlag">鍘荤即璐�</el-button>
                         </el-form-item>
                     </el-form>
-<!--                    <el-form label-width="100px" label-position="left">-->
-<!--                        <el-form-item label="璇疯緭鍏ユ墜鏈哄彿" style="margin-left: 5px;">-->
-<!--                            <el-input v-model="carNo" placeholder="璇疯緭鍏ユ墜鏈哄彿"></el-input>-->
-<!--                        </el-form-item>-->
-<!--                        <el-form-item style="display: flex;justify-content: center;margin-top: 2px" label-width="0">-->
-<!--                            <el-button class="jiaofei-btn" type="primary" @click="noCarOut()" v-show="showFlag">鏃犵墝鍑哄満缂磋垂</el-button>-->
-<!--                        </el-form-item>-->
-<!--                    </el-form>-->
+                    <el-form
+                        class="carSearch"
+                        label-position="left">
+                        <el-form-item
+                            class='formLabel'
+                            style="display: flex;
+                            flex-direction: column;align-items: center;justify-content: center"
+                            label="鏃� 鐗� 杞� 杈� 鏌� 璇�">
+                            <el-input prefix-icon="el-icon-search" style="margin-top: 20px;border: solid 1px #ccc!important;" v-model="carNo" placeholder="璇疯緭鍏ユ墜鏈哄彿"></el-input>
+                        </el-form-item>
+                        <el-form-item class="weizhang-footer-box" style="display: flex;justify-content: center;margin-top: 5.498vh" label-width="0">
+                            <el-button
+                                style="borderColor:'none';background:#121215e0 "
+                                class="jiaofei-btn" type="primary" @click="noCarOut()" v-show="showFlag">鏌ヨ</el-button>
+                        </el-form-item>
+                    </el-form>
 
                 </div>
 
@@ -68,6 +76,7 @@
                 showFlag2:true,
                 status3:0,
                 carNo:"",
+                oldCarNo:"",
                 code2:""
             }
         },
@@ -85,6 +94,7 @@
                 this.statisticData = res.data;
                 this.outParkId = this.statisticData.id;
                 this.status3 = this.statisticData.status3;
+                this.oldCarNo = this.statisticData.carNo;
                 this.payFlag = false
                 if(this.status3==1){
                     this.$message({
@@ -112,25 +122,25 @@
                 })
             },
             noCarOut(){
-                if(this.carNo){
-                    this.$byutil.postData(this, this.$systemconfig.basePath + '/outpark/outPark2', {code2:this.code2,carNo:this.carNo}, res => {
-                        if(res.success){
-                            this.outParkId = res.data.id;
-                            this.pay();
-                            this.showFlag = false;
-                        }else{
-                            this.$message({
-                                message: res.msg, type: 'error', duration:2000,
-                            });
-                        }
-
+                if(this.oldCarNo == '鏃犺溅鐗�'){
+                  if(this.carNo){
+                    this.$byutil.postData(this, this.$systemconfig.basePath + '/ffzf/car/outParkByPhone', {code2:this.code2,carNo:this.carNo}, res => {
+                      if(res.code===0){
+                        this.statisticData = res.data;
+                        this.outParkId = this.statisticData.id;
+                      }
                     })
-                }else{
+                  }else{
                     this.$message({
-                        message: '璇疯緭鍏ユ墜鏈哄彿',
-                        type: 'error',
-                        duration:2000,
+                      message: '璇疯緭鍏ユ墜鏈哄彿',
+                      type: 'error',
                     });
+                  }
+                }else {
+                  this.$message({
+                    message: '闈炴硶杈撳叆',
+                    type: 'error',
+                  });
                 }
 
             },
@@ -245,4 +255,21 @@
     .weizhang-main-bootom{
         margin-top: 0.333rem  /* 25/75 */;
     }
+    .formLabel{
+      ::v-deep .el-form-item__label{
+        font-size: 18px;
+      }
+      ::v-deep el-input{
+        border: solid 1px #ccc!important;
+
+      }
+
+    }
+    .carSearch{
+      border:solid 1px #ccc;
+      margin-top: 15%;
+      border-radius: 4%;
+      box-shadow: 0px 0px 0px 10px;
+
+    }
 </style>

--
Gitblit v1.9.1